## Market Summary

## **Global ****Digital Freight Forwarding Market Overview**

The Digital Freight Forwarding Market Size was estimated at 45.15 (USD Billion) in 2024. The Digital Freight Forwarding Industry is expected to grow from 51.62 (USD Billion) in 2025 to 172.46 (USD Billion) by 2034. The Digital Freight Forwarding Market CAGR (growth rate) is expected to be around 14.34% during the forecast period (2025 - 2034).

## **Digital Freight Forwarding Market Segment Insights**

### **Digital Freight Forwarding Market Business Process Insights**

Business Process of the Digital Freight Forwarding Market has recorded a substantial market size. The Logistics market witnesses a higher demand for digital mediums, driving the growth of the Digital Freight Forwarding market. The shredding away of manual and paper-dependent operations is a major cause of the growth of this market. Shipment Management is a major process in freight forwarding. It is the activity of planning, executing, and monitoring the delivery of goods from one location to another.

Digital Freight Forwarders adopt innovative technology to facilitate Shipment Management.This includes real-time tracking of shipments, automotive routing and scheduling of shipments, and the use of data analytics for predicting the demand for shipments. These technologies provide greater opportunities for businesses to understand inventory requirements, reduce costs and enhance overall customer experience. Documentation and Compliance are also major parameters in Freight Forwarding. Digital Freight Forwarders are focusing on digitizing the documentation process for simplification of the process and to circumvent delays in paper documentation and the risks of non-compliance and legal penalties.

They are also providing efficient compliance checks, through automated technological tools. The use of digital permissions to sign documents, electronic documentation systems, etc., are some of the modern tools of technology. Customs Clearance is a tedious and delayed process. Digital Freight Forwarders are dispatching technology to fasten the clearance process and to ensure risk-free, paperless, and remote Custom Clearances through the use of EDI systems and automated tariff classification of products. Freight Booking is an essential aspect of Freight Forwarding.It involves the reservation of freight capacities and maintenance of favorable relationships with freight service providers.

The technology adopted includes online booking, real-time availability of capacities, and dynamic pricing models. Cargo Visibility and Tracking are mandatory for delivery services as well as the recipients of the deliveries. Technologies used include GPS tracking, RFID tags, and IoT sensors for tracking progress and identifying risks. ### **Digital Freight Forwarding Market Technology Insights**

Technology Segment Insights and Overview The technology segment plays a pivotal role in the growth of the Digital Freight Forwarding Market. Cloud computing, artificial intelligence (AI), blockchain, and the Internet of Things (IoT) are key technologies driving market expansion. Cloud computing offers scalable and cost-effective data storage and processing capabilities, enabling freight forwarders to manage vast amounts of data efficiently. AI algorithms automate tasks, optimize routes, and provide predictive analytics, enhancing operational efficiency.Blockchain technology ensures secure and transparent data sharing among stakeholders, reducing fraud and improving collaboration.

IoT devices track shipments in real time, providing visibility and enhancing supply chain management.

Full Truckload (FTL): Dominant vs. Air Freight: Emerging

Full Truckload (FTL) serves as the dominant force in the service type segment of the Digital Freight Forwarding Market. FTL is characterized by its ability to transport [full truckloads](https://www.marketresearchfuture.com/reports/full-truckload-transportation-market-39823) of goods directly to their destination, making it highly efficient for shippers with large volumes. The service promises reduced transit times and costs per unit compared to other service types. On the other hand, Air Freight represents an emerging segment, experiencing rapid growth driven by e-commerce and urgent delivery needs. While usually more expensive than FTL, Air Freight offers unmatched speed and is critical for businesses where time is a crucial factor. Automotive: Dominant vs. Healthcare: Emerging

The Automotive sector is characterized by its extensive supply chains and the necessity for precise logistics management. This segment thrives on the demand for timely deliveries, as automakers aim to minimize production delays. On the other hand, the Healthcare segment is rapidly gaining ground due to the heightened awareness of supply chain resilience following recent global health challenges. The demand for temperature-sensitive shipping and regulatory compliance makes Healthcare logistics particularly complex, creating opportunities for digital freight forwarders to innovate and meet those needs.

## Regional Market Share Analysis

### North America : Digital Transformation Leader

The North American digital freight forwarding market is primarily driven by technological advancements and increasing demand for efficient logistics solutions. The region holds approximately 45% of the global market share, making it the largest market. Regulatory support for digitalization and sustainability initiatives further catalyze growth, as companies seek to optimize supply chains and reduce costs. Leading countries in this region include the United States and Canada, with major players like Flexport, [Freightos](https://www.freightos.com/glossary/freight-forwarding/), and Shipwell dominating the landscape. The competitive environment is characterized by innovation and partnerships, as companies leverage technology to enhance service offerings. The presence of established logistics firms and startups alike fosters a dynamic market, ensuring continuous evolution in freight forwarding solutions.

### Europe : Emerging Digital Hub

Europe is witnessing a significant shift towards digital freight forwarding, driven by the need for efficiency and transparency in logistics. The region accounts for approximately 30% of the global market share, making it the second-largest market. Regulatory frameworks, such as the EU's Digital Single Market strategy, are encouraging the adoption of digital solutions, enhancing cross-border trade and logistics efficiency. Key players in Europe include Transporeon, DHL Global Forwarding, and Zencargo, with Germany and the UK leading the charge. The competitive landscape is marked by a mix of traditional freight forwarders and innovative tech startups, creating a vibrant ecosystem. The focus on sustainability and digital transformation is reshaping the market, as companies invest in technology to meet evolving customer demands. The European Commission emphasizes the importance of digitalization in logistics for economic growth.
